A traffic collision was reported on northbound Interstate 5 near the southbound State Route 163 connector, according to California Highway Patrol dispatch records. The report came in at 1:53 p.m. on July 25, 2026, with an ambulance requested to the area, which typically signals possible injuries, though the extent was not confirmed in the dispatch entry.
The dispatch record did not specify how many vehicles were involved or what may have caused the crash, and no injury count was given.

California accident information
- Injury stat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of injury (CCP 335.1).)
- Wrongful death stat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of death (CCP 377.60).)
- Fault rule
- California uses pure comparative negligence: partial fault reduces recovery proportionally but does not bar it.
- Citations
- CCP 335.1 (SoL); CCP 377.60 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Li v. Yellow Cab
- Crash report agency
- California Highway Patrol (CHP 190 request) for CHP-investigated crashes; local police/sheriff otherwise.
